Her husband is a Super Bowl winning QB, his daughter is obsessed with dinosaurs. Kelly Stafford and her bestie Hank Winchester know a thing or two about pressure, the spotlight, and keeping it all together for their kiddos. The Morning After with Ryan Murphy on Child Swim Safety
Q: What are the signs parents should look for regarding dry drowning?
Parents should monitor for consistent coughing, breathing difficulty, vomiting, and lethargy after a child has been in water.

What is The Morning After about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focuses on the humorous and chaotic sides of parenting and family life, particularly in a modern context that includes balancing professional sports and career demands. The hosts share personal stories, tackle relatable parenting challenges like managing children's schedules and emotions, and often feature anecdotes about the pressures of sports culture, especially in the realm of NFL. This podcast uniquely blends laughter and insightful discussions about the realities of family life, parenting philosophies, and navigating the ups and downs of raising children in today's world.
